About Tookan

Tookan is a comprehensive delivery management platform designed to streamline and optimize your delivery operations. It offers real-time tracking, route optimization, and efficient task management to ensure timely and accurate deliveries.

About Blender

Blender is a powerful open-source 3D creation suite that supports the entirety of the 3D pipeline, including modeling, rigging, animation, simulation, rendering, compositing, and motion tracking. It is widely used by artists, designers, and developers for creating stunning visual effects, animations, and interactive 3D applications.
